Observe offers a modern, cloud-native architecture for observability that addresses the limitations of outdated systems by efficiently managing large data volumes without escalating costs. Traditional observability tools often struggle with increasing data and associated expenses due to their outdated architecture, relying on complex data management techniques that burden users. In contrast, Observe centralizes all data types into a low-cost, Amazon S3-based Data Lake, compressing data significantly and storing it for 13 months by default. It accelerates frequently accessed data into a structured Data Graph, enabling efficient query execution on the Snowflake Data Cloud's shared infrastructure, which significantly reduces costs. The system employs a usage-based pricing model with administrative controls to prevent excessive spending, allowing users to manage their data consumption effectively. This approach not only simplifies data management but also enhances performance and cost efficiency for users, making Observe a viable option for those seeking a scalable observability solution.

The Observe Azure App, part of the Observe Apps suite, is designed to enhance multi-cloud observability by integrating telemetry data from Azure services with existing observability data. The app supports major cloud platforms, including AWS, GCP, and Azure, and focuses on correlating various data sets for deeper insights. It includes out-of-the-box components such as Dashboards, Datasets, and Monitor templates for popular Azure services like Azure Kubernetes Service (AKS), Functions, SQL Databases, SQL Managed Instances, and Virtual Machines. These tools help users monitor metrics, troubleshoot issues, and gain insights into their cloud environments. The Azure App's unique feature is the Data Graph, which allows users to link datasets to discover new relationships and trace changes over time, offering a comprehensive view of service performance and user experience. The app facilitates the creation of custom dashboards and monitors, enabling proactive alerting and more informed decision-making, thus making it easier for developers to manage and optimize their Azure cloud environments.

As economic uncertainties loom, many companies, particularly in the tech sector, face reduced budgets, layoffs, and increased workloads, creating a challenging environment where maintaining service quality is critical despite fewer resources. Observability emerges as a strategic approach to address these compounded challenges by improving system insights and reducing complexity, helping organizations adapt to data growth without necessarily increasing costs. Unlike traditional monitoring, observability focuses on unifying various data types—such as logs, metrics, and traces—to provide actionable insights, streamline tool usage, and enhance data visibility. As organizations prioritize observability to mitigate risks and improve operational efficiency, there is a growing emphasis on using scalable architectures and pricing models that align with data usage, while avoiding the pitfalls of siloed data and costly legacy systems. Despite the challenges, investing in observability can help organizations maintain service levels, manage complex IT environments, and prepare for future growth by enabling faster incident resolution and better resource allocation.
